It's Paris,, and Céline Montclair age, Stephen Herondale age, and Robert Lightwood are on a mission for the Circle/Valentine.
He wants the Shadow Market shut down because he doesn't want people mixing with Downworlders, and this is where Celine's path crosses with Jem, She sees that he is in search of a silver necklace with a pendant in the shape of a heron, which he finds at a booth run by a kid.
He wanted it in order to track down Jack Crow, to tell him who he really is,
The greater storyline is Celine's and a choice she has to make in this that will define her character and her future.
She has a heartbreaking story with abusive parents, no friends, and no one to love her, But when she made the wrong choice of what to do with her life, it was extremely disappointing and sad, We all know she ends up pregnant with Jace and then murdered, Her story is just heartbreaking from start to finish, But this story was so beautifully written all the same,

Below, I'll summarize what we learned about every character, so it will include spoilers for this short story,
Céline Montclair had a rather unpleasant childhood: her parents used to lock her up in a basement whip her set demons on her leave her for the night in a werewolfridden wood.
So it's no wonder she's so easily taken in by Valentine, who is the first person in her life to tell her that she is exceptional.
She isnow and in her last year of Shadowhunter Academy, After that, she can finally leave her parents' house,
Stephen Herondalehas now become Valentine's right hand man as Luke has become a vampire, Stephen is married to Amatis, but Celine has a crush on him, However, he views her as childish, says she will always needs someone to look out for her, and laughs at the idea of him ever being with Celine, which hurts Celine so badly.
Rosemary is actually the lost Herondale, not her husband Jack, and she warns Celine that Valentine is not who she thinks he is.
This leads Celine to spying on Valentine, and she finds out that he had paid the warlock they were hunting to lie and give a false confession against two Shadowhunters that Valentine wanted dead.
Valentine gives Celine a choice: she can leave and try and warn the Consul who have never believed her when she's gone to them about her parents, or she can stay with him, and he will make sure Stephen falls in love with her.
She knows if she chooses Stephen, that two innocent Shadowhunters will be murdered, But she makes that choice anyway,
Jem, besides what I mentioned above, he also meets up with Tessa at the end of this one and tells her about the Lost Herondale.
